How can i downgrade from 10 to 9. My watch is no fun to use due to energy problems

installed 10 yesterday. Before one charge lasted 40 to 48 hours. Now less than 20.

This is normal for a day or two after a major version upgrade. The first steps to load the new version are only a small part of the task. After your device is returned with new software loaded there are many hidden background tasks like cleaning the old software files, and reindexing all the storage. These will increase battery load but it is only temporary. I would expect your Apple Watch should be back at normal behavior and battery life sometime over the weekend.
